Publisher's Synopsis

This book integrates fuzzy rule-languages with genetic algorithms, genetic programming, and classifier systems with the goal of obtaining fuzzy rule-based expert systems with learning capabilities. The main topics are first introduced by solving small problems, then a prototype implementation of the algorithm is explained, and last but not least the theoretical foundations are given.
The second edition takes into account the rapid progress in the application of fuzzy genetic algorithms with a survey of recent developments in the field. The chapter on genetic programming has been revised. An exact uniform initialization algorithm replaces the heuristic presented in the first edition. A new method of abstraction, compound derivations, is introduced.
